Assessing Your Backyard and Planning the Format
When you're prepared to install a lawn sprinkler system, the very first step is reviewing your backyard and planning the format. Begin by observing the dimension and shape of your yard. Determine areas that require watering, such as flower beds, lawns, and vegetable yards. Bear in mind of sun direct exposure and any kind of shaded areas, as these variables affect water needs.
Next, consider the water stress available to you. Check it using a simple pressure gauge to confirm your system can operate effectively. Plan the placement of lawn sprinkler heads based upon protection; you'll desire them to overlap somewhat to stay clear of completely dry spots.
Sketch a rough design, noting the areas of the major lines and sprinkler heads. Believe about the sorts of lawn sprinklers you'll utilize and their reach. Planning thoroughly currently will make your installment easier and confirm your plants get the appropriate quantity of water.

Necessary Devices Needed
Mounting a lawn sprinkler calls for a particular collection of tools and products to guarantee a successful configuration. You'll require a shovel to dig trenches for the piping. A pipe cutter will assist you reduce the PVC or polyethylene pipes to the ideal sizes. Don't fail to remember a determining tape to validate accurate placements and distances. A level is crucial for verifying your lawn sprinkler heads are mounted correctly. When required, you'll likewise need a wrench for tightening up installations and a drill for making openings. Lastly, a pair of gloves will protect your hands during the installation procedure. Marking the Automatic Sprinkler Style
As you begin marking the automatic sprinkler style, take into consideration the format of your lawn and the locations that need the most insurance coverage. Start by identifying areas like flower beds, yards, and veggie gardens that require regular watering. Usage stakes or flags to detail the areas where you plan to set up the sprinklers.
Next, confirm you represent challenges, such as trees or outdoor patios, which may block water circulation. Step distances meticulously to establish the very best positioning for each and every lawn sprinkler head. Bear in mind to room them evenly, following the maker's referrals for coverage.
You might intend to sketch an easy layout of your design to visualize the format better. This will help you make modifications as required. Confirm your significant areas to validate that each area is properly covered before relocating on to the next steps in your installation procedure.

Installing Lawn Sprinkler Heads and Valves
Installing lawn sprinkler heads and shutoffs official statement is a critical action in creating an effective watering system for your yard or garden (Sprinkler system check). Begin by placing the lawn sprinkler heads at the marked areas, making sure they're equally spaced for perfect coverage. Dig a tiny opening for every head, confirming it's deep enough for proper installment
Following, attach the sprinkler heads to the pipelines, protecting them tightly to prevent leakages. Use Teflon tape on the threads for extra guarantee.
When it involves valves, select a place conveniently accessible for maintenance. Mount the valves according to the maker's directions, linking them to the mainline pipes. Ensure they're degree and protected, as this will certainly aid with consistent water circulation.
Lastly, examination each sprinkler head and shutoff for appropriate function before hiding any type of pipes. This action guarantees your system operates smoothly and effectively, offering the very best care for your plants.
